One of the primary benefits of ultra thin 7 segment display modules is their space efficiency. As devices become increasingly miniaturized, manufacturers are constantly seeking ways to reduce size while maintaining functionality. The ultra thin profile of these display modules allows designers to incorporate them into compact devices without compromising on visual clarity or readability. This is particularly advantageous in applications such as wearables, home appliances, and automotive dashboards, where space is at a premium.
Another key advantage is their energy efficiency. Ultra thin 7 segment displays typically utilize LED technology, which consumes significantly less power compared to traditional display technologies. This energy-efficient design not only contributes to longer battery life in portable devices but also aligns with growing consumer demand for eco-friendly electronics. The ability to provide bright, clear visuals without excessive power consumption makes these displays an appealing choice for manufacturers aiming to create energy-efficient products.
In addition to their design benefits, ultra thin 7 segment display modules are also known for their versatility. They can be used in a variety of applications, including clocks, counters, measurement devices, and even simple user interfaces. Their straightforward design allows for easy integration into a wide array of electronic systems, making them a favorite among engineers and designers. Furthermore, advancements in manufacturing processes have enabled the production of these displays with varying colors, brightness levels, and even customized designs, allowing for greater adaptability in different devices.
Reliability is another important factor that makes ultra thin 7 segment display modules a sought-after choice in consumer electronics. These displays are typically designed to withstand a range of environmental conditions, including temperature fluctuations and humidity, making them suitable for both indoor and outdoor applications. Additionally, their robust construction ensures longevity, reducing the need for replacements and contributing to overall device durability.
